Reinvigorate your innovation approach with business ecosystems In a
business ecosystem, different companies collaborate along and
across previously sacrosanct industry barriers, encouraging
innovation and the development of groundbreaking new products and
services. Design Thinking for Business Growth delivers an
eye-opening, fresh approach to designing and scaling business
models and ecosystems. In this book, Michael Lewrick delivers a
comprehensive procedural model for the design, development, and
implementation of business ecosystems. He also presents the most
critical design methods and tools you'll need to make your own
ecosystem a success. Fleshed out case studies and examples of
companies with successful business ecosystem initiatives A mindset
for business growth, including the use of "design lenses" and the
exploitation of momentum and speed to facilitate innovation
Practical exercises to better understand and implement the ideas
discussed in the book Perfect for founders, managers, and
executives in industries of all types, Design Thinking for Business
Growth also belongs in the libraries of product managers,
department heads, and non-profit professionals who wish to better
understand how to develop new and innovative ideas that lead to
company growth and success. With a topical view of the design
paradigm, Design Thinking for Business Growth complements the
international bestsellers The Design Thinking Playbook and The
Design Thinking Toolbox. If you are ready to apply a new design
thinking mindset for remarkable business growth, Design Thinking
for Business Growth is your ultimate tool for success.
The Design Thinking Life Playbook is for anyone who wants to have a
fulfilling and joyful future. It s for all those who want to
initiate change through self-empowerment and have the courage to
think, act, and take advantage of their opportunities proactively.
Whether you want to change your career, form healthier, stronger
relationships, or plan the next stages of your life, this book will
guide you to something better. Authors Michael Lewrick, Larry
Leifer, and Jean-Paul Thommen are leading design thinking experts
in the U.S., Europe, and Asia. Michael Lewrick, Ph.D., is a
featured speaker and teaches design thinking at various
universities. With Leifer, Lewrick co-authored the international
bestseller The Design Thinking Playbook as well as The Design
Thinking Toolbox. Stanford Professor Larry Leifer, Ph.D., is one of
the most influential personalities and pioneers in design thinking.
Professor Jean-Paul Thommen, Ph.D., from the University of Zurich,
is an expert on leadership, organizational development, and
business ethics.
How to use the Design Thinking Tools A practical guide to make
innovation happen The Design Thinking Toolbox explains the most
important tools and methods to put Design Thinking into action.
Based on the largest international survey on the use of design
thinking, the most popular methods are described in four pages each
by an expert from the global Design Thinking community. If you are
involved in innovation, leadership, or design, these are tools you
need. Simple instructions, expert tips, templates, and images help
you implement each tool or method. Quickly and comprehensively
familiarize yourself with the best design thinking tools Select the
appropriate warm-ups, tools, and methods Explore new avenues of
thinking Plan the agenda for different design thinking workshops
Get practical application tips The Design Thinking Toolbox help
innovators master the early stages of the innovation process. It's
the perfect complement to the international bestseller The Design
Thinking Playbook.
A radical shift in perspective to transform your organization to
become more innovative The Design Thinking Playbook is an
actionable guide to the future of business. By stepping back and
questioning the current mindset, the faults of the status quo stand
out in stark relief--and this guide gives you the tools and
frameworks you need to kick off a digital transformation. Design
Thinking is about approaching things differently with a strong user
orientation and fast iterations with multidisciplinary teams to
solve wicked problems. It is equally applicable to (re-)design
products, services, processes, business models, and ecosystems. It
inspires radical innovation as a matter of course, and ignites
capabilities beyond mere potential. Unmatched as a source of
competitive advantage, Design Thinking is the driving force behind
those who will lead industries through transformations and
evolutions. This book describes how Design Thinking is applied
across a variety of industries, enriched with other proven
approaches as well as the necessary tools, and the knowledge to use
them effectively. Packed with solutions for common challenges
including digital transformation, this practical, highly visual
discussion shows you how Design Thinking fits into agile methods
within management, innovation, and startups. Explore the digitized
future using new design criteria to create real value for the user
Foster radical innovation through an inspiring framework for action
Gather the right people to build highly-motivated teams Apply
Design Thinking, Systems Thinking, Big Data Analytics, and Lean
Start-up using new tools and a fresh new perspective Create Minimum
Viable Ecosystems (MVEs) for digital processes and services which
becomes for example essential in building Blockchain applications
Practical frameworks, real-world solutions, and radical innovation
wrapped in a whole new outlook give you the power to mindfully lead
to new heights. From systems and operations to people, projects,
culture, digitalization, and beyond, this invaluable mind shift
paves the way for organizations--and individuals--to do great
things. When you're ready to give your organization a big step
forward, The Design Thinking Playbook is your practical guide to a
more innovative future.
